MySQL的u命令用户管理利器(mysql中u命令的作用)

MySQL的u命令:用户管理利器

MySQL数据库作为目前应用最广泛的一种关系型数据库,其安全性较高,支持多种安全认证方式。用户管理作为其中的一项重要功能,可以帮助用户进行对数据库的权限管理。MySQL提供了一系列用于管理用户权限的命令,其中一个很有用的命令就是u命令。

一、u命令介绍

u命令是MySQL数据库中的一个重要命令,全称为“User Command”,即用户命令。它主要用于创建、修改、删除用户账户和设置账户的权限。在使用u命令之前,需要先登陆MySQL。

二、u命令的常见用法

1.创建用户

使用u命令创建MySQL用户的格式为:

CREATE USER ‘用户名’@’登录主机’ IDENTIFIED BY ‘密码’;

其中,用户名表示要创建的用户的名称;登录主机指允许该用户使用MySQL的主机地址,例如localhost或者%;密码表示要为该用户设置的密码。

例如:

CREATE USER ‘testuser’@’localhost’ IDENTIFIED BY ‘password’;

2.授予权限

使用u命令授予MySQL用户权限的格式为:

GRANT 权限列表 ON 库名.表名 TO ‘用户名’@’登录主机’;

其中,权限列表可以是多个权限,例如SELECT、INSERT、UPDATE等;库名和表名分别表示要对哪个库和哪个表的权限进行修改。

例如:

GRANT SELECT, INSERT ON test.* TO ‘testuser’@’localhost’;

3.修改密码

使用u命令修改MySQL用户密码的格式为:

SET PASSWORD FOR ‘用户名’@’登录主机’=PASSWORD(‘新密码’);

例如:

SET PASSWORD FOR ‘testuser’@’localhost’=PASSWORD(‘newpassword’);

4.删除用户

使用u命令删除MySQL用户的格式为:

DROP USER ‘用户名’@’登录主机’;

例如:

DROP USER ‘testuser’@’localhost’;

三、u命令的相关注意事项

1.u命令不应该被随意使用,因为涉及到数据库的安全问题,如果误操作会对数据库的整体安全性造成影响。

2.在使用u命令之前,最好先创建数据库并设置好访问权限,以免对数据库的管理产生不必要的麻烦。

3.在使用u命令创建用户时,用户的名称和密码应该设置得足够安全,以避免恶意用户的攻击。

结语:

MySQL的u命令是一种非常有用的用户管理工具,可以帮助用户进行灵活的权限管理和账户管理。但是,在使用u命令时需要注意安全问题,保证数据库的整体安全性。


数据运维技术 » MySQL的u命令用户管理利器(mysql中u命令的作用)